Focus Partners Wealth raised its position in shares of Extreme Networks, Inc. (NASDAQ:EXTR - Free Report) by 25.3%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 324,736 shares of the technology company's stock after acquiring an additional 65,535 shares during the period. Focus Partners Wealth owned approximately 0.24% of Extreme Networks worth $4,296,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

Insider Transactions at Extreme Networks

In related news, CFO Kevin R. Rhodes sold 14,000 shares of the firm's stock in a transaction dated Thursday, August 28th. The stock was sold at an average price of $21.52, for a total transaction of $301,280.00. Following the sale, the chief financial officer owned 126,202 shares of the company's stock, valued at $2,715,867.04. This trade represents a 9.99% decrease in their ownership of the stock. Also, CEO Edward Meyercord sold 35,725 shares of the firm's stock in a transaction dated Friday, August 1st. The shares were sold at an average price of $17.18, for a total value of $613,755.50. Following the sale, the chief executive officer directly owned 1,541,282 shares in the company, valued at approximately $26,479,224.76. The trade was a 2.27% decrease in their position. Extreme Networks (NASDAQ:EXTR -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, August 6th. The technology company reported $0.25 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$0.22 by $0.03. Extreme Networks had a positive return on equity of 82.47% and a negative net margin of 0.65%.The business had revenue of $307.00 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$299.88 million.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ned ($0.08) EPS. The business's revenue was up 19.6%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, sell-side analysts anticipate that Extreme Networks, Inc. will post 0.31 earnings per share for the current year.

About Extreme Networks

Extreme Networks, Inc delivers cloud-driven networking solutions that leverage the powers of machine learning, artificial intelligence, analytics, and automation. The company designs, develops, and manufactures wired and wireless network infrastructure equipment and develops the software for network management, policy, analytics, security, and access controls.
